Ward Transport & Logistics Corp. is a family-owned and operated asset-based LTL, truckload, brokerage, and warehousing provider based in Altoona, PA. Founded in 1931 by William W. Ward as a “one truck, two man” operation, Ward was the first to offer Central Pennsylvania farmers access to the New York City market where produce was in great demand. Ward hauled produce through the streets of Manhattan in exchange for cases of oil to take back to his rural suppliers. Over the years, Ward Transport & Logistics Corp. has evolved into more than just a trucking company.

Carrier Spotlight Of the Month: Kingdom Freight

In 2010, with one truck and trailer on the road—driven by co-owner Alton Moore—Kingdom Freight was officially in business. Today, with 115 dry vans, 58 trucks, 8 flatbeds, and 2 temperature controlled trucks, owners Alton and Cindy Moore attribute the Charleston, MS, company’s growth to their dedication to upholding commitments to customers and providing on time delivery. Carrier Spotlight of the Month: Parrish Leasing Co.The Road

In 1970, Herschel and Elaine Parrish founded Parrish Leasing, a company that put Herschel’s love of trucks to good use. Today, the company has grown into a successful trucking business in Freeburg, IL, with 100 trucks on the road. The Parrish family still owns the company, and the third generation still plays an active role in the day-to-day management of the fleet. Parrish is our carrier of the month.
